You are on page 1of 12

No.

1 Vo Van Ngan Street, Thu Duc Dist., HCMC, VN


Tel: +84 8 37221223, Fax: +84 8 38960640

H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

ĐIỀU KHIỂN TRƯỢT


SLIDING MODE CONTROL

05/29/2023 1
Điều khiển trượt
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

Xét hệ thống phi tuyến được biểu diễn bởi phương trình vi
phân:
(1)
Đặt (2)
Ta được biểu phương trình biểu diễn trạng thái

05/29/2023 2
Điều khiển trượt
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

Vấn đề: Xác định luật điều khiển u sao có tín hiệu ra bám theo
tín hiệu
Mặt trượt: Định nghĩa hàm
(3)
Với là tín hiệu sai lệch: (4)
Trong đó được chọn sao cho đa thức đặc trưng của phương
trình vi phân sau HurWitz

Khi đó nếu thì sai lệch khi


05/29/2023 3
Điều khiển trượt
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

Thay (4) và (2 ) vào (3), ta được


(5)

Phương trình xác định một mặt cong trong không gian n chiều
gọi là mặt trượt (Sliding surface).
Vấn đề: Xác định luật điều khiển u để đưa quỹ đạo pha của hệ
thống về mặt trượt và duy trì trên mặt trượt một cách bền vững
đối với biến động của f(x) và g(x)

05/29/2023 4
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

Lấy đạo hàm (5) và áp dụng (2) ta có:

(6)
Có thể chọn (7)
Trong đó là một hằng số dương chọn trước. Luật điều khiển
được chọn bởi:

(8)

05/29/2023 5
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

Tính bền vững của hệ thống: Trong điều kiện có sai


số của mô hình, luật điều khiển (8) luôn đưa quỹ đạo
pha của hệ thống về mặt trượt S=0 nếu điều kiện sau
được thỏa mãn:

(9)

05/29/2023 6
Điều khiển trượt
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

 Ưu điểm
Tính bền vững cao (High Robustness)
Ít nhạy với sự biến thiên các thông số của hệ thống và nhiễu
Đáp ứng động học nhanh
Dễ dàng được thực hiện
 Nhược điểm
- Hiện tượng Chattering
- Việc thiết kế bộ điều khiển trượt yêu cầu phải biết mô hình
toán học cùng các thông số của mô hình của đối tượng

05/29/2023 7
Ví dụ thiết kế bộ điều khiển trượt
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

Thiết kế bộ điều khiển trượt điều khiển con lắc với biểu diễn
trạng thái:

Tín hiệu đặt (ứng với vị trí nằm ngang của con lắc)

Ta chọn mặt trượt:


Ta có:

05/29/2023 8
Ví dụ thiết kế bộ điều khiển trượt
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

 Để và trái dấu ta chọn luật điều khiển

(trong đó ta chọn và )
Hệ thống điều khiển mô phỏng trên matlab simulink

05/29/2023 9
Ví dụ thiết kế bộ điều khiển trượt
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

Mô hình con lắc

Bộ điều khiển trượt


trên Matlab Simulink

05/29/2023 10
Ví dụ thiết kế bộ điều khiển trượt
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

Kết quả mô phỏng

Đáp ứng của hệ thống

05/29/2023 11
Ví dụ thiết kế bộ điều khiển trượt
HCMC UNIVERSITY OF TECHNOLOGY AND EDUCATION

Kết quả mô phỏng

Quỹ đạo của mặt trượt Tín hiệu điều khiển u

05/29/2023 12

You might also like